Review of Miss Peregrine's Home for Peculiar Children (2016) by Richard Roeper for Chicago Sun-Times — 28 Sep 2016
This is a messy, confusing, uninvolving mishmash of old-school practical effects and CGI battles that feels … off nearly every misstep of the way. It’s like watching a master musician play a piano he somehow doesn’t realize is out of tune.
